The Xbox Experience

Apparently, Microsoft is reinventing the operating system on the 360 to make it more like the Wii (in the sense that you get to make an avatar or whatever). Even more interesting, is a partnership with netflix where you can stream movies and tv shows live. You’ll also be able to install games to your hard drive which creates a 30% reduction in load times, and Devil May Cry 4 installs in just 10 minutes.

I’ve found a bunch of stuff about this thing, you guys should just google it.

Yeah, I heard about that. Man, I wonder how much less obnoxious it would be to play Lost Odyssey if you could install it. SO much loading in that damned game!